Thank you @siwangqixiang for the idea, it's not supported for now unless we remove the definition of the index before more data to be inserted, then, at some point, to create the index again and trigger the rebuild. The thing is, thus, the index on existing data is not usable after the index definition deletion before it's rebuild.

Otherwise, it's a feature similar to this #2635, which is not supported yet.
